Mk. Pillay et R. Ganesan, Kinetics of reaction of triethylammonium carboxylates with ethyl alpha-halogenoacetate in various solvents, INT J CH K, 31(12), 1999, pp. 894-900
The kinetics of the reaction of ethyl alpha-halogenoacetate with benzoic ac
id in the presence of triethylamine in aqueous acetone and in various solve
nts have been investigated The rate constant of the reaction is 4-260 times
higher in aprotic dipolar solvents than in protic solvents. The simple reg
ression and multiple regression of log k(2) with various solvent parameters
have led to the conclusion that in addition to the solvent polarity, vario
us other solvent properties, together or individually, influence the reacti
on rate, (C) 1999 John Wiley C Sons, inc.
